+ -
当前位置:首页 → 问答吧 → 如何对这组数字字典进行重新排列?

如何对这组数字字典进行重新排列?

时间:2011-02-07

来源:互联网

有两组 数据列表

A数据组如下

01 02 03 04 05 06
03 02 15 16 19 10

B 组数据组如下
02  210
01  201
16  270
03  222
04  213
10  290
05  232
06  245
15  265
19  280


根据A,B组数据字典,最终得到c组数据组如下:
201 210 222 213 232 245
222 210 265 270 280 290

作者: vitas333_cu   发布时间: 2011-02-07

  1. awk 'NR==FNR{a[$1]=$2}NR>FNR{for(i=1;i<=NF;i++){$i=a[$i]};print $0}' b a
复制代码

作者: zzy7186   发布时间: 2011-02-07

回复 zzy7186


谢谢,很实用。。 :)

作者: vitas333_cu   发布时间: 2011-02-07

热门下载

更多